4K Virtual Cycle - Bordeaux - France
Let yourself be enchanted by the beauty of Bordeaux in France.
Bordeaux is a wonderful port city located in the southwest of France.
The city is built on a bend of the river Garonne and the city of Bordeaux
itself was declared at a World Heritage Site in 2007. Bordeaux is classified
as “City of Art and History”.
Enjoy impressive sights such as the Bordeaux Cathedral, the Pont de pierre
and the Place de la Bourse. Bordeaux is famous for its architectural and cultural
heritage.
|